The Aboriginal Land Rights (Northern Territory) Act 1976 (ALRA) is Australian federal government legislation that provides the basis upon which Aboriginal Australian people in the Northern Territory can claim rights to land based on traditional occupation.

Commonwealth, State, and Territory Parliaments of Australia have passed Aboriginal land rights legislation. The Act specified an end date of June 1997, by which claims had to be lodged. It was the first law by any Australian government that legally recognised the Aboriginal system of land ownership, and legislated the concept of inalienable freehold title, as such was a fundamental piece of social reform.

The Aboriginal Land Rights (Northern Territory) Amendment Bill 2006, in effect from 1 July 2007, [8] added several clauses intended to promote economic development in remote townships.

The community is located 170 km (106 mi) south of Tennant Creek, and 378 km (235 mi) north of Alice Springs. Approval by TOs and residents at the time the S.19A Lease is issued, effectively bind later TOs and residents.

The summary of the amendments includes the following effects of the amendments: they "increase access to Aboriginal land for development, especially exploration and mining; facilitate the leasing of Aboriginal land and the mortgaging of leases; provide for a tenure system for townships on Aboriginal land that will allow individuals to have property rights; devolve decision-making powers to regional Aboriginal communities", and change the provisions governing land councils to increase accountability. A significant review of the Act (referred to as ALRA) was undertaken from October 1997, when the government appointed barrister John Reeves to examine its effectiveness, operation of aspects relating to mining and the Aboriginal Benefits Trust Account, and the role of the Land Councils.
